New Holland ENG 146 – ENGINE Controller (Engine ECU): Coolant Temperature level has exceeded the warning limit.
Issue description
The engine is overheating. The coolant temperature sensor is reading a temperature that has surpassed the safe operating threshold programmed into the system, triggering an engine protection mode.

Check the cause
Visual Airflow Inspection (Most Common): Check the radiator, cooling stack, and screens for blockages caused by dirt, dust, and chaff.
Coolant Level & Condition: Once the engine is cool, check the overflow tank and radiator for proper coolant levels and signs of contamination (e.g., oil in the coolant).
Thermostat Check: Feel the upper and lower radiator hoses. If the engine is overheating but the hoses are completely cool to the touch, the thermostat is likely stuck closed.
Fan Operation: Inspect the viscous fan clutch or electric fan logic to ensure the fan is engaging properly under load.
Sensor Accuracy: Use a diagnostic tool to verify the actual coolant temperature reading against a manual temperature probe. If the engine is physically cool but the ECU reads it as overheating, the sensor has failed.
Hydraulic/PTO Load: Ensure the machine isn't overheating strictly due to hydraulic overload or a stuck valve causing excessive engine drag.
Repair steps
Clean radiator fins and screens
If the Radiator is Blocked: Use compressed air to blow out the radiator fins and screens.
Separate and clean coolers
If heavily packed, separate the coolers in the cooling stack to clean trapped debris thoroughly.
Drain engine coolant
If the Thermostat is Faulty: Drain the engine coolant into a clean drain pan.
Remove thermostat housing
Unbolt and remove the thermostat housing.
Remove old thermostat
Remove the old thermostat and scrape away any old gasket material.
Install new thermostat
Install the new thermostat (typically rated for 180°F / 82°C) and a new gasket.
Reattach housing
Reattach the housing and torque the bolts to OEM specifications.
Locate coolant temperature sensor
If the Coolant Temperature Sensor is Faulty: Locate the sensor on the engine block or thermostat housing.
Disconnect wiring harness
Disconnect the 2-pin wiring harness.
Unscrew old sensor
Unscrew the old sensor (have the new one ready to minimize coolant loss if you haven't drained the system).
Install new sensor
Thread in the new sensor (e.g., 1/2" x 14 NPTF thread) and tighten.
Reconnect wiring harness
Reconnect the wiring harness.
Refill cooling system
Final Steps: Refill the system with the OEM-specified coolant mixture.
Bleed cooling system
Bleed the cooling system to remove any trapped air pockets.
Verify repair under load
Run the tractor under load to verify the temperature stabilizes and the ENG 146 code clears.
